How are the Sportsman 500's? (or 400's) are they dependable? Do they ride nice? ARe they tippy, esp going up steep hills?)

Been looking at one ....04's are much cheaper but 05's look nice...26" tires, extra travel in suspension

I'm not looking for high speed thrills or winning any races.....just wanna get there in comfort and not get stuck too many times....going through mostly trails, some rough, a bit of mild mud and a bit of bad mud, muskeg, some rough hilly terrain, wanna pull the occasional log out of bush.

Stuck between getting one of following

Suzuki Vinson..........no locker though but only one Ive had out on trail ride
Sportsman 400/500 2004 or 2005
2005 Kodiak 450 with IRS......nice ride, lacks a little on get up and go though

Also Brute Force 650's are selling for a little less than price of 05 Vinsons, Sportsmans and Kodiaks, but they are new...and hear a lot about belt problems with VTwin Kawis and I assume they use alot of gas too

i have a 2002 sportsman 500 h.o it breaks belt left and right, howerver with stock tires it will be fine, its the big tires and lift that kill me.

and the heelclicker clutch sloved my belt problem.

the motors on the polaris arent nearly as smooth as on the jap bikes.
